WMP MPEG Layer-3 option missing

Following a reinstall of Windows XP Professional, Windows Media Player is missing the MPEG Layer-3 option, Tools>Options>Copy Music>Copy Settings.

I used the Dell Reinstallation CD to install Windows XP Professional onto a second hard drive, that I installed following Dell technical support said that I should back up and reformat the original hard drive, following problems with an inaccessible task bar.

I know that there are plugins that can be purchased to add MP3 and have purchased one for another computer but would like to reactivate the MP3 option that still exists on the old hard drive that I havn't yet reformatted. I hope to eventually solve the task bar problem and have the option of being able to boot from either hard drive.

Microsoft Knowledge Base Article - 306494 talks about creating a registry key but I don't know how to do this. Even if I did this, would it solve the problem or is there a simpler solution?

Using Regedit I succesfully added MP3 to WMP, as described in the Microsoft Article 306494.
